这里是文章模块栏目内容页
存储过程编写mysql(存储过程编写教程)

导读:

存储过程是MySQL中一种重要的数据库对象,它可以将一组SQL语句封装成一个可重复使用的单元。本文将介绍如何编写MySQL的存储过程,包括存储过程的创建、调用和删除等操作。

1. 创建存储过程

创建存储过程需要使用CREATE PROCEDURE语句,语法如下:

CREATE PROCEDURE procedure_name([IN|OUT|INOUT] parameter_name data_type)

BEGIN

-- SQL statements

END;

其中,procedure_name为存储过程的名称,parameter_name为参数名称,data_type为参数类型。IN表示输入参数,OUT表示输出参数,INOUT表示既可以输入也可以输出。

2. 调用存储过程

调用存储过程需要使用CALL语句,语法如下:

CALL procedure_name([parameter_value]);

其中,procedure_name为存储过程的名称,parameter_value为参数值。

3. 删除存储过程

删除存储过程需要使用DROP PROCEDURE语句,语法如下:

DROP PROCEDURE procedure_name;

其中,procedure_name为存储过程的名称。

总结:

本文介绍了MySQL存储过程的创建、调用和删除等操作,对于提高数据库性能和代码复用性有很大帮助。在实际开发中,应该根据具体需求合理使用存储过程,避免滥用造成不必要的性能损失。